About Péter Móra

Péter Móra is a scholar working on Geophysics, Computational Mechanics, Mechanics of Materials, Artificial Intelligence and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law, having authored 122 papers that have together received 3.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include earthquake and tectonic studies (43 papers), Seismic Imaging and Inversion Techniques (20 papers), Lattice Boltzmann Simulation Studies (20 papers), Earthquake Detection and Analysis (20 papers), Seismic Waves and Analysis (17 papers), Landslides and related hazards (17 papers), Seismology and Earthquake Studies (17 papers) and High-pressure geophysics and materials (17 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Geophysics (2.1k citations), Ocean Engineering (980 citations),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law (477 citations), Mechanics of Materials (685 citations) and Computational Mechanics (522 citations). Péter Móra has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include D. G. Place, Heiner Igel, Steffen Abe, Yucang Wang, Dion Weatherley, Yinghong Wang, Fernando Alonso-Marroquín, Shane Latham, Hans J. Herrmann and I. Vardoulakis. Their work appears in journals such as Pure and Applied Geophysics, Geophysical Journal International, Geophysics, Transport in Porous Media and Granular Matter.
